| // ChannelUniqueQueue implements UniqueQueue
 | |
| //
 | |
| // It is basically a thin wrapper around a WorkerPool but keeps a store of
 | |
| // what has been pushed within a table.
 | |
| //
 | |
| // Please note that this Queue does not guarantee that a particular
 | |
| // task cannot be processed twice or more at the same time. Uniqueness is
 | |
| // only guaranteed whilst the task is waiting in the queue.
 | |
| type ChannelUniqueQueue struct {
 | |
| 	*WorkerPool
 | |
| 	lock               sync.Mutex
 | |
| 	table              map[string]bool
 | |
| 	shutdownCtx        context.Context
 | |
| 	shutdownCtxCancel  context.CancelFunc
 | |
| 	terminateCtx       context.Context
 | |
| 	terminateCtxCancel context.CancelFunc
 | |
| 	exemplar           interface{}
 | |
| 	workers            int
 | |
| 	name               string
 | |
| }
